Context: The project ‘Marine litter and microplastics: promoting the environmentally sound management of plastic waste and achieving the prevention and minimization of the generation of plastic waste’ (BRS-Norad-1), financed by the Norwegian Agency for Development Cooperation (Norad), seeks to prevent and significantly reduce marine litter and microplastics by strengthening capacity in Ghana. It is being implemented by the Secretariat of the Basel, Rotterdam and Stockholm Conventions (BRS Secretariat) in close collaboration with Ghana’s Ministry of Environment, Science, Technology & Innovation (MESTI) and the Basel Convention Coordinating Centre for Training and Technology Transfer for the African Region, Nigeria (BCCC Nigeria). BCCC-Nigeria is supporting the implementation of a series of pilots in Ghana under this project. In this context, the sale of edible/compostable packaging will be tested in various restaurants/shops in Ghana. An entity is needed to produce and ship the edible and compostable packaging and provide related advisory services during the implementation of the pilot. Description of services to be rendered: The selected entity will undertake the following activities/provide the following services under the supervision of BCCC-Nigeria and in close collaboration and consultation with the BRS Secretariat, MESTI and other relevant partners:

  1. Produce approximately 7,000 units of edible/compostable packaging, such as for the storage of take-away food, sauces, beverages etc.
  2. Ship the edible/compostable packaging to a location to be specified in Ghana.
  3. Provide substantive support in the organization of a launch/promotion event.
  4. Provide advisory services throughout the testing of the sale of the packaging, such as related to the organization of a launch/promotion event, development of information material, handling of the packaging etc.
